Indicate the main reason for the establishment of patriarchy.

Patriarchy (a lifestyle in which a man plays a leading role in the household) replaced matriarchy (a lifestyle in which a woman plays a leading role in the household) in the Bronze Age. The main reason for the establishment of patriarchy was the growing role of men in production. Men worked the land, grazed cattle, etc. A lot of work appeared, requiring more human strength.
